工控软件开发前景广阔,潜力巨大-工控软件开发前景广阔-制造业用于生产过程的自动化控制和管理
工控软件开发前景广阔,潜力巨大
工控软件开发行业正在快速发展,技术需求不断增长,市场潜力巨大。特别是随着工业自动化和智能制造的普及,工控软件成为了现代工业发展的重要支撑。
一、市场潜力巨大
工控软件在多个行业中都有广泛应用,从制造业到能源、交通、医疗等领域。随着全球工业自动化程度的提高,工控软件的需求量呈现出爆发式增长。尤其是中国制造2025和德国工业4.0等国家战略的推进,为工控软件的发展提供了强大的推动力。
特别是在现代制造业中,工控软件的作用尤为突出。它不仅能提高生产效率,降低运营成本,还能实现生产过程的自动化和智能化。
行业 | 工控软件应用 |
---|---|
汽车制造 | 从零部件加工到整车装配的全自动化生产 |
能源 | 发电、输电、配电等环节的自动化控制 |
二、技术需求不断增长
工控软件开发需要掌握多种技术,如编程语言、实时操作系统、工业协议等。随着技术的不断进步,工控软件的功能和性能也在不断提升。
- 编程语言和开发工具:常用的编程语言包括C、C++、Python等。
- 实时操作系统(RTOS):常见的RTOS包括FreeRTOS、VxWorks、QNX等。
- 工业协议和通信技术:常见的工业协议包括Modbus、Profibus、Ethernet/IP等。
三、应用领域广泛
工控软件的应用领域非常广泛,涵盖了制造业、能源、交通、医疗等多个行业。每个行业对工控软件的需求都有其独特的特点和要求。
- 制造业:用于生产过程的自动化控制和管理。
- 能源行业:用于发电、输电、配电等环节的自动化控制和管理。
- 交通行业:用于交通设备的自动化控制和管理。
- 医疗行业:用于医疗设备的自动化控制和管理。
四、发展趋势与挑战
工控软件开发前景广阔,但也面临着一些挑战和发展趋势。
- 智能化和数字化:随着工业4.0和智能制造的推进,工控软件需要具备更高的智能化和数字化水平。
- 安全性和可靠性:工控软件的安全性和可靠性是其关键性能指标。
- 跨平台和互操作性:工控软件需要在多种硬件平台和操作系统上运行。
五、工控软件开发平台与工具
选择合适的开发平台和工具是工控软件开发的关键。
- 集成开发环境(IDE):如Visual Studio、Eclipse、Code::Blocks等。
- 实时操作系统(RTOS):如FreeRTOS、VxWorks、QNX等。
- 工业协议栈:如Modbus、Profibus、Ethernet/IP等。
- 仿真和测试工具:如MATLAB/Simulink、LabVIEW、Proteus等。
六、工控软件开发的最佳实践
为了提高工控软件的开发效率和质量,开发人员需要遵循一些最佳实践。
- 需求分析和设计:充分了解客户需求,制定详细的需求规格说明书(SRS),并进行系统设计。
- 模块化和可重用性:将工控软件划分为多个独立的功能模块,并确保每个模块具有良好的接口和封装性。
- 代码质量和测试:编写高质量的代码,遵循编码规范和最佳实践,进行单元测试、集成测试和系统测试。
- 文档和培训:编写详细的文档,包括需求文档、设计文档、用户手册等,并进行培训。
七、未来的工控软件开发
工控软件开发的未来充满了机遇和挑战。随着工业自动化和智能制造的不断推进,工控软件将会在更多的领域和更深的层次上发挥作用。
- 物联网(IoT)与工控软件:通过物联网技术,实现对工业设备的远程监控和控制。
- 人工智能(AI)与工控软件:使工控软件更加智能化。
- 云计算与工控软件:为工控软件提供更加灵活和高效的计算资源。
八、工控软件开发的案例分析
通过一些具体的案例分析,可以更好地理解工控软件开发的实际应用和效果。
- 案例一:某汽车制造企业的工控软件应用,实现了生产过程的全自动化控制。
- 案例二:某风力发电企业的工控软件应用,实现了对风力发电机组的自动控制和监测。
- 案例三:某轨道交通企业的工控软件应用,实现了对列车的自动控制和调度。
九、结语
工控软件开发前景广阔,技术需求不断增长,市场潜力巨大。开发人员需要不断学习和掌握新的技术,遵循最佳实践,提高工控软件的开发效率和质量。
相关问答FAQs:
- Q1: 工控软件开发有哪些发展前景?
- Q2: 工控软件开发人才需求如何?
- Q3: 工控软件开发带来的收益有哪些?